Vishnu Wood Carving (IBH343)

Description

This fine wood carving shows Vishnu in an unusual seated posture with both Devis on his knees. Compare to depictions of Vishnu standing in Samapada such seated ones are quite uncommon, even more so with the complete iconography of Sri and Bhu Devi. All are seated on a large lotus under a double arch decorated with garlands.

Vishnu is featuring the chakra and conch in his upper hands while the lower ones embrace the Devis while holding the gada and a second not yet identified attribute.

A crack runs through the base and lotus that does not distract from the beauty of the serene and benign expression of all the three faces, especially Vishnu's.
